Horticulture & Grounds Technician to start June 2026. Kennington School is a new SEN school for children on the autism spectrum, opening September 2026. Reporting to the Facilities Manager, the Estates Horticulture and Grounds Technician is responsible for grounds maintenance and related activities to ensure that the Kennington school site is maintained to an excellent standard.
